Objective

The student is able to
- explain the character of project work and determine when the project work model is useful
- present the basic knowledge and skills on the basis of which he/she can participate in project work and project planning
- explain concepts connected with projects, content of a project plan, project time planing and supervising (life circle)
- present tasks connected with the different phases of the project cycle

Content

- concepts and methods of project work
- project phases and process
- project plan (time, resource and cost planning)
- project organisation and interest groups
- changes, risks and problems in project work
- project communication and reporting
- concluding a project

Teaching methods

The course consist of general and field-specific parts.
There is a two-credit general part in Moodle, on which an online exam is based, and a one-credit project plan (field specific imaginary or real project). The field-specific part can contain contact teaching, eg examples of successful projects

Student workload

54 hours studies at Moodle, 10 hours contact lessons, 17 hours distance work.
